I have just had the awesome privilege of ministering in a small country town North of Perth. The people were beautiful, the Presence of God was very rich, and the Grace of God was abundant! Living in the city we take so many things for granted, but in the country people travel miles to get to their local fellowship on a Sunday morning. It is such a treasure to meet people who Love the Lord Jesus Christ, and who have faithfully served their community without "apparent" signs of much impact or growth. I have such respect for the men and women of God who toil and serve and pour out the Love and Grace of God for years, and still have the same passion and dedication evident in their lives.
Part of the Word The Lord gave me was about there being Provision for the vision......
Habakkuk 1;5 Look around you Habakkuk (replied the Lord) among the nations and see! And be astonished! Astounded! For I am putting into effect a work in your days (Such) that you would not believe it if it were told you (Acts 13:40,41)
Habakkuk 2:2 And The Lord answered me and said Write the vision and engrave it so plainly upon tablets that everyone who passes by may be able to read it easily and quickly as he hastens by.For the *vision* is yet for an *appointed* time and it hastens to the end (fulfilment) IT WILL NOT DECEIVE NOR DISAPPOINT. THOUGH IT TARRY WAIT (ERNESTLY) FOR IT BECAUSE IT WILL SURELY COME; IT WILL NOT BE BEHINDHAND ON ITS APPOINTED DAY
God said that He is PRO - (for) the VISION (God ordained, inspired vision for His will to be done). His vision will not deceive, nor disappoint. We need to hold on to the glorious hope of the appointed time being fulfilled so that the vision may come to pass.
Then The Lord gave me another scripture which refers to having confidence ....
Heb 10;35-36 Do not therefore fling away our fearless confidence for it carries a great and glorious compensation of reward. 36 For you have need of steadfast patience and endurance, so that you may perform and fully accomplish the will of God and thus receive and carry away (and enjoy to the full) what is promised.
I guess the message in all of this is hang on tight to the Vision God has given you, and be patient and endure so that you may do the will of the Father, which, in turn leads to great enjoyment and fulfillment of what God has ordained! The joy that is set before us is to run the race to the best of our ability.... for the Glory of God.
